导语

本文将以老年智能护理为例解释如何使用Waylay平台结合不同的AI技术。该项目的核心目标是提供一种解决方案:向护理人员和家人确认他们所照顾的人员健康情况。下图介绍了所有相关的参与者。

在这个用例中存在很多挑战:

  • 在任何时候,我们都需要掌握平台对老年人、看护人和家庭成员的建议;

  • 不能简单地通过在整个地方添加传感器来训练网络;

  • 我们想要应用的一些规则应该表达而不需要任何“学习”(使用启发式或看护人或老年人的愿望)

  • 较少干预,但拥有“足够好”的规则让人们独立生活,同时为他们提供自由空间(例如,我们可以将摄像机放在房子的每个角落,但是谁愿意像那样生活?)

我们经常说:“数据不言自明”,所以,让我们看一下其中一次试验中得到了什么样的数据。我们将传感器放在冰箱、前门、橱柜、窗帘以及轮椅上。除了使用传感器数据之外,还选择了不同情况的老年人、看护人和家庭成员,通过使用该应用程序给他们共享图片和发送消息。以下是来自不同家庭的几个典型日子的直方图:

本文不详细介绍数据是如何处理的,我们直接查看这些直方图,其中的一些信息可以省去:

  • 可以扣除人们在工作日或周末每天每个时段移动的可能性等;

  • 可以减去人们使用不同对象的频率;

  • 使用马尔可夫过程,可以估计一个人在不同房间之间移动的可能性;

  • 可以扣除睡眠模式;

  • 使用无监督聚类,可以对具有相似模式的老年人进行分组;

  • 可以定期检查过去几周的移动模式是否与前一个时期相比是不寻常的,这可能是阿尔茨海默病的第一个迹象;

基于老年人和看护人输入规则

如前所述,应该用一些规则表达,而不需要任何“学习”。在该项目期间,Studio Dott提供了获取这些规则的好方法:

  1. 选择一个对象(冰箱,窗帘,壁橱,门等);

  2. 选择“何时”的状态(早上,晚上等);

  3. 如果对象在时间窗口中移动或不移动,则在工作日或周末移动;

  4. 超过或少于X次;

  5. 如果条件满足,则向个人发送短信和/或电子邮件;

找出老年人是否睡眠障碍

在下面的规则模板中,我们将运动传感器、似然传感器、日/夜传感器和每小时传感器组合在一起,以便推断出该人是否有睡眠问题。值得注意的是:我们观测的是运动情况,所以即使他们在夜间醒来,而且经常这样做,我们也不会将那个夜晚标记为睡眠问题。这样,我们只关注模式的变化。

一段时间后电器没有关闭

如果被看护人忘记关闭设备,我们可以在一段时间后发送警报(根据设备类型使用不同的时间段):

在该示例中,根据传感器输入和对象类型(如电视),Waylay会在设备开启且未再次关闭的情况下发送警报(确切的窗口可由延迟传感器控制)。如果在同一时间窗口内注册了多个开/关事件,将会丢弃。

建模马尔科夫链

马尔科夫链是一个随机过程,经历从一个状态到另一个状态的转换。

假设我们有一座四个房间的屋子,房间之间的连接如上图所示。每个房间的总移动概率应该等于1(用相同颜色标记)。这种方式建模的一个问题是转换表可能在一天内发生变化(注:这与马尔科夫链的“无记忆”特征不同,因为整个过程可能不仅取决于先前的状态)。

为此,我们使用简单事件关联(事件彼此接近的频率)和Waylay的驱动策略功能及与门。在这个动画中,我们可以看到如何获取一个人从卧室移动、走楼梯、通过卧室、打开冰箱的模式。在同一规则中,如果冰箱在上午11点之前没有打开过一次,将发送短信。

人工智能和物联网的结合

借助可以适用不同AI和ML技术的平台,可以使用以下信息:

  • 实时事件

  • 在时间序列数据库中获取历史数据

  • 物体层面上的元模型(是电视机,热水锅炉的对象,或者如果水表在给定的区域/街道中,等等)

  • 实时分析模块(与ML的连接用于培训参数,例如主动维护,目标定时时间等),这些函数可以在运行时通过插件界面进行更新

  • ML模型,如深度学习

  • 来自第三方的API调用(用于通知,图像对象识别,NLP等)

结语

随着我国老龄化愈加的明显,智能看护机器人、智能护理应用程序应运而生。这些智能产品不再只是冷冰冰的机器,它能够像人类沟通、能够进行人类情感的分析,最主要的是,它能够从大量的数据中发现人们无法直接观察的信息,根据每个人的特殊指标进行有针对性的护理。

长按二维码 ▲

订阅「架构师小秘圈」公众号

如有启发,帮我点个在看,谢谢↓

基于人工智能和物联网的“智能护理相关推荐

  1. 基于人工智能智商研究的智能定律初探

    什么是智能和意识一直是智能科学领域最基础也是最具有争议的问题,2014年以来,我们在对人机通用智能发展水平的进行研究时提出了标准智能模型,统一描述人和智能机器的特征.在这个研究的基础上,2020年5月 ...

  2. (毕业设计资料)基于STM32的物联网WiFi智能家居控制系统

    092[电路方案]基于STM32的物联网WiFi智能家居控制系统 功能: 1.可以检测环境中温湿度,气压,一氧化碳,空气质量,烟雾浓度和光照强度. 2.将测量的值显示在屏幕上,数据上报机智云平台可以通 ...

  3. 基于STM32设计物联网在线智能称重系统(OneNet)_2022

    1. 前言 本设计的模型来源于物流.矿山.高速公路等场合,车辆称重地螃的智能化升级要求.需要结合这些场合,设计基于物联网的智能在线称重方案,开发智能称重控制器,合理选择部署多个重量传感器和必要的算法. ...

  4. 基于DJYOS的物联网危险源智能监测平台

    1 产品系统框架 天津滨海爆炸事故的发生为全国各地的安全生产,特别是对危险化学品的安全监管敲响了警钟.那么如何检测危险以及评判危险等级是当前迫切需求.我们所设计的物联网危险源智能监测平台就是用来管理和 ...

  5. 基于stm32的物联网、智能家居控制系统

    文章目录 前言 一.环境介绍 二.功能说明 三.代码修改 总结 前言 使用onenet平台进行远程传输数据和远程控制开发板,但由于onenet官方给的代码只对他家的开发板比较友好,对于初学者来说修改这 ...

  6. 智能连接:5G与人工智能、物联网等技术的超级融合

    来源:资本实验室 随着新技术的成熟,新型的.先进的应用将来自5G.人工智能(AI)和物联网(IoT)的融合.这种融合将创造出一个智能连接的世界,对所有个人.行业.社会和经济产生积极影响. 从现在到20 ...

  7. 基于物联网的智能家居系统设计(课设)

    基于物联网的智能家居系统设计(课设) 摘 要 一.概述 二.系统分析 三.系统设计 四.系统实现 1.硬件实现 2.软件实现 五.结论与心得 六.参考文献 摘 要   科技的快速发展给人们的生活带来了 ...

  8. 基于物联网的智能医护系统研究

    1 引 言 目前,我国医院信息化建设处于探索阶段,临床护理业务仍采用人工操作半自动化的方式来实现.由于临床护理工作复杂琐碎,患者信息的采集.分类.汇总.保存占据了大量的人力.物力和时间,并且护理人员不 ...

  9. 基于物联网的智能家居

    基于物联网的智能家居 摘要:随着科学技术的飞速发展和生活水平的提高,人们对智能生活的需求也在不断增加.智能家庭的自动化是社会信息发展的重要组成部分,同时从个人.公共服务和政府的需要出发,在物联网给智能 ...

最新文章

  1. 推荐系统技术演进趋势:召回-排序-重排
  2. 使用qwt作曲线图——有网格线背景的画法
  3. 在GridView中添加按钮后,如何触发按钮的各种事件?
  4. Docker中操作镜像和容器的常用命令
  5. python find函数实现原理_非常干货:Python 探针实现原理
  6. 20140120收藏夹
  7. 二级VB培训笔记04:程序控制结构、数组和过程
  8. MySQl中文1001无标题_Mysql中字段类型不一致导致索引无效的处理办法
  9. 不可忽视的IT运维管理
  10. c语言乘法除法结合律,有关C语言运算符优先级和结合律的思考
  11. openGL使用方法教程
  12. 几何平均回归Geometric Mean Regression——使用Python实现
  13. 电池SOC仿真系列-基于遗传算法的电池参数辨识
  14. 重磅!2019上海落户政策大全!
  15. 学会保护自己的眼睛!
  16. c语言综合设计作业医院管理系统,C语言之医院管理系统
  17. 中国机械对流烘箱行业市场供需与战略研究报告
  18. ARP家族--ARP,代理ARP,Gratuitous ARP
  19. Hgame-Week3
  20. html input 比字长,旺财记账项目-Money.vue组件实现(上)

热门文章

  1. 置换 ---- 两个置换最少swap次数 E. Permutation Shift
  2. python中的 怎么用_Python中如何调用Linux命令
  3. c++语言static作用,详解c++中的 static 关键字及作用
  4. 保留两位小数除法算式_北师大|五年级上册|第一周周测·小数除法(1)
  5. 2016-2017 ACM-ICPC CHINA-Final(EC-final) 题解(10 / 12)
  6. Codeforces 1408 D. Searchlights(优化DP、思维)
  7. oracle 查看连接数语句,Oracle数据库中查询连接数的实用sql语句
  8. 二元logistic模型案例_二元逻辑回归的简介与操作演示
  9. 【Java例题】2.1复数类
  10. 使用编译器——Solidity中文文档(8)